About Food and Beverage Services Courses

Food and Beverage Services Courses provide students with skills required to prepare, present as well as service food and beverages to customers. These courses also allow the students to complete training at any reputed hotel and gain some experience. There are many courses available in Food and Beverage Services. The duration of these courses varies from 6 months to 3 years. Some of the courses available in Food and Beverage Services are BSc in Food Science and Nutrition, BSc in Food Technology, BSc in Hospitality and Hotel Administration, Diploma in Hotel Management and Post Graduate Diploma in Food Safety and Quality Management. 

Candidates can apply for these courses depending on their qualifications. They can check the eligibility criteria, course duration, syllabus and admission process of Food and Beverage Services Courses provided on this page.

Food and Beverage Services Courses Eligibility Criteria

The eligibility criteria of all the Food and Beverage Services Courses is provided below. 

Courses

Eligibility Criteria

Undergraduate Courses

Passed 12th from any recognised board.

Postgraduate/ PG Diploma Courses

Completed bachelor’s degree with at least 45% marks

Diploma Courses

Passed 10th from any recognised board.

Food and Beverage Services Courses Admission Process

Admission to Food and Beverage Services courses is done on the basis of candidates’ performance in the qualifying degrees. Candidates who are interested in admission to any of the Food and Beverage Services Courses can fill the application form. They can either download the application form from the college website or they can collect it from the campus. Once the candidates are selected for admission, they will be called for document verification. 

Candidates should note that there are some of the colleges that also conduct an aptitude test/ personal interview for selection. Candidates can visit the official website of the selected college to know more about the admission process.

Food and Beverage Services Career Options and Job Prospects

After completing Food and Beverage Services Courses, candidates can work in hotels, restaurants, F&B services, resorts, guest houses and tourism companies. Besides this, they can also start their own catering business. Those who have completed a diploma or bachelor’s level program in Food and Beverage Services can enrol for a master’s level program. They can also enrol for a master’s degree in hotel management such as Master of Hotel Management, Master of Tourism and Hotel Management, MBA in Hospitality Management.
